About:72-Hour Visa-Free Transit

Guangzhou I have an Italian passport.

If I book a flight by China Southern Rome-Bangkok a/r via Guangzhou I don’t need visa because my transit in Guangzhou airport is 3 hours (Rome-Bangkok) and 5 hours (Bangkok-Rome). It’s correct?

You are correct that you don't need a visa for this trip.
